Integer Technologies and Southern Miss Awarded $9.8M to Increase U.S. Navy Seabed Warfare Capabilities

Integer Technologies, a leading provider of mission assurance and reliability software for maritime operations, and 果冻传媒麻豆社 (USM) today announced it was awarded a $9.8 million option exercise contract modification from the Office of Naval Research for the next phase of its Intelligent Autonomous Systems for Seabed Warfare joint program.

This option exercise is part of the  and expands the Navy鈥檚 ongoing investment in the joint Integer鈥揢SM effort, bringing the total cumulative contract value to $24.8 million, and supports the development of novel software to help the U.S. Navy maintain maritime dominance and increase its seabed warfare capabilities. The modification provides continuing research and development of an operational decision support tool for autonomous undersea missions that will allow unmanned vessels to adapt more effectively to changing ocean conditions and operate for longer periods of time with minimal human intervention.
